The Comparison
π© is more universally and frequently used across all platforms due to its simplicity and versatility as a basic female reference emoji.
ππ» officially represents two women holding hands with light skin tone, emphasizing companionship and togetherness,
Officialπ© simply represents a single woman as a generic female figure.
ππ» is used by Gen Z to celebrate female friendships, queer relationships, or 'bestie' culture, whereas π© is seen as a basic, utilitarian emoji for referencing a woman or oneself.
Genzππ» carries warmth, solidarity, and emotional connection between two people,
Emotionalπ© is emotionally neutral and often used as a standalone descriptor without relational depth.
ππ» can signal a same-sex relationship or a close romantic bond between women in dating contexts,
Datingπ© is rarely used in dating scenarios unless describing oneself or another person plainly.
ππ» appears in memes celebrating female friendships or 'girls supporting girls' culture,
Memeπ© shows up in memes as a generic stand-in for 'woman' in jokes or scenarios.
On TikTok, ππ» is popular in WLW (women loving women) content and bestie appreciation videos,
Tiktokπ© is more functional, used in text overlays or captions to indicate a female subject.
On WhatsApp, ππ» is sent between close female friends to celebrate their bond or a fun outing,
Whatsappπ© is used more practically to refer to a woman in a conversation or as a quick self-reference.
Use ππ» when celebrating a female friendship, a girls' trip, a queer relationship, or any moment of feminine solidarity and togetherness. Use π© when you simply need to reference a woman, describe yourself, or add a female figure to a sentence or caption. Reserve ππ» for relational contexts and π© for individual or descriptive ones.
